Sunday 16th April - Swadlincote Round-Up

Welcome to the match round-up for the Swadlincote Sunday 6 a side league held at The Pingle Academy on the state of the art 3G surface. All teams across the division attended for some excellent matches. Let's take a closer look at the results:

Swad's Unfittest 4-0 Corona Rovers:

In the first match of the day, Swad's Unfittest showed their dominance with a 4-0 win over Corona Rovers. The result was the sixth clean sheet in a row for the winners, who have been in exceptional form of late. Swad's Unfittest dominated from the start, with their attacking prowess too much for Corona Rovers to handle. Their clinical finishing and solid defense ensured a comfortable victory and yet another clean sheet.

Budweiser FC 3-2 Underdogs:

The match between Budweiser FC and Underdogs was a closely fought affair, with both teams battling hard for the win. Budweiser FC took the initiative though and saw off their opponents in an end to end encounter.

Deportivo De La Zouch 3-3 Paralympiakos:

The match between Deportivo De La Zouch and Paralympiakos was a thrilling encounter, with both teams putting on an excellent display of attacking football. The match was evenly poised throughout, with both teams trading blows and never allowing the other to take a decisive lead. The match ended in a 3-3 draw, with both teams earning a well-deserved point.

Lawnmower FC 0-0 Athletico De Swad:

The final match of the day saw Lawnmower FC take on Athletico De Swad in a tight encounter. Despite both teams having their chances, neither side could break the deadlock and the match ended in a 0-0 draw. Lawnmower FC's defense was resolute throughout the match, denying Athletico De Swad any clear-cut chances. In the end, both teams had to settle for a point apiece.
